Claims (22)
- 하기 식 I의 화학적 구조를 가지는 물질의 조성물:
식 Ⅰ
상기 식에서,
n은 1, 2, 또는 3 이고, 질소 원자 사이의 페닐 고리는 서로 연결 및 질소 원자에 각 결합에 대하여 독립적으로 선택되는 파라 또는 메타 배치로 결합될 수 있으며,
각각의 R1, R2, R3 및 R4 는 독립적으로 하기로 이루어진 군에서 선택되고,
상기 점선은 상기 식 I 내의 질소 원자와 결합되는 위치를 나타내고,
R1, R2, R3 및 R4 중 하나 이상은 하기로 이루어진 군에서 선택되며,
각각의 R1, R2, R3 및 R4는, R1, R2, R3 및 R4에 융합되지 않는 치환기로 더 치환될 수 있다. - 애노드;
캐소드;
애노드와 캐소드 사이에 배치되고 호스트와 인광성 도판트를 더 포함하는 유기 발광 층;
애노드와 유기 발광 층 사이에 배치되고, 유기 발광 층과 직접 접촉되어있으며, 정공 수송 물질을 포함하는 유기 정공 수송 층;
을 포함하는 유기 발광 소자에 있어서,
상기 정공 수송 물질은 하기 식 I의 구조를 가지는 것인 유기 발광 소자:
식 I
상기 식에서,
n은 1, 2, 또는 3 이고, 질소 원자 사이의 페닐 고리는 서로 연결 및 질소 원자에 각 결합에 대하여 독립적으로 선택되는 파라 또는 메타 배치로 결합될 수 있으며,
각각의 R1, R2, R3 및 R4 는 독립적으로 하기로 이루어진 군에서 선택되고,
상기 점선은 상기 식 I 내의 질소 원자와 결합되는 위치를 나타내고,
R1, R2, R3 및 R4 중 하나 이상은 하기로 이루어진 군에서 선택되며,
각각의 R1, R2, R3 및 R4는, R1, R2, R3 및 R4에 융합되지 않는 치환기로 더 치환될 수 있다. - 제18항에 있어서, 상기 도판트는 유기 금속 이리듐 물질인 것인 유기 발광 소자.
- 제20항에 있어서, 상기 호스트는 벤조-융합 티오펜을 함유하는 트리페닐렌을 포함하는 화합물인 것인 유기 발광 소자.
- 하기 식 I의 화학적 구조를 지닌 물질의 조성물을 더 포함하는 유기 발광 소자를 포함하는 것인 소비재 물품:
식 Ⅰ
상기 식에서,
n은 1, 2, 또는 3 이고, 질소 원자 사이의 페닐 고리는 서로 연결 및 질소 원자에 각 결합에 대하여 독립적으로 선택되는 파라 또는 메타 배치로 결합될 수 있으며,
각각의 R1, R2, R3 및 R4는 독립적으로 하기로 이루어진 군에서 선택되고,
상기 점선은 상기 식 I 내의 질소 원자와 결합되는 위치를 나타내고,
R1, R2, R3 및 R4 중 하나 이상은 하기로 이루어진 군에서 선택되며,
각각의 R1, R2, R3 및 R4는, R1, R2, R3 및 R4에 융합되지 않는 치환기로 더 치환될 수 있다.
